Transponder keys

A key that has a chip transponder is a great way to protect your vehicle from theft. It sends a distinct signal to the immobilizer system of your vehicle that stops it from starting when the key is not in close to. These keys are more expensive to replace. It is recommended to keep a no spare in case you lose your keys.

Transponders are found in the majority of BMWs, making them more difficult to get. The transponder chip emits a unique code which is wirelessly transmitted by the key to the car's computer. It will only begin the engine if the key is within the range of the car's immobilizer. The chip also sends an indication to the ignition lock that will stop the car from starting without the correct key.

If your key has a transponder, you will be required to bring it to a licensed locksmith or dealer for replacement. These experts will have the equipment necessary to program the new key and make sure it's functioning properly. If your key fob gets lost or stolen, they can provide you with a brand new one.

The first step is to verify ownership. step to replacing the transponder. If you have proof of ownership, the process can be completed in a short time. You can use your driver's permit, title, insurance card or any other document that proves ownership. The process can be a bit complicated in the event that you do not have evidence of ownership.

Keys lost or stolen

A BMW key does more than start your vehicle. It's an advanced piece of equipment that is that is designed to increase security and make it difficult for criminals to take cars. Its transponder chip is a crucial element that communicates with the vehicle's security system. The car will not start without it. This makes BMWs more secure and harder to take, but it also complicates replacing keys that are stolen or lost. You can purchase an alternative key from the dealership. However you can also call an independent locksmith or auto shop for help.

A locksmith who is licensed and experienced is the best option for BMW key replacement, as they have the experience and abilities to provide top-quality services. They can also help you with other services, including key programming and lock repair. They are also trained in handling European automobiles that require special tools.

The first step to obtain an replacement key is to identify your VIN. The 17-character code is unique to BMW. It is located on your vehicle registration certificate the insurance policy or the title. The VIN is required to verify ownership of the vehicle, and to stop keys that are not legitimate being duplicated.

Once you have the VIN contact your local dealership to order a replacement key. The majority of dealerships will do this however it could take a while. You can reduce the waiting time by calling an independent locksmith or repair shop for your vehicle for those in a hurry.

You should confirm the status of the replacement key after you have contacted the dealership. If it hasn't arrived yet, you may ask them to mail it to you. You'll likely be charged a fee to make use of this service.

Certain locksmiths from independent companies will replace a BMW key that was stolen or lost however, they may charge more than dealerships. It is recommended to get an estimate from several locksmiths before settling on one. Ask if they have the appropriate equipment to replace your BMW keys, especially when you have a smart key or proximity keys. A reputable locksmith will be able to cut a replacement key in a safe manner and without causing any further damage. They will also adhere to the proper verification protocols and will not invalidate your warranty.

Battery Replacement

A key fob in Marietta is the easiest method to start your car or unlock your doors. The battery of a key fob is the sole element that makes it function and it's crucial to replace it before its lifespan expires. Fortunately, replacing the battery in a BMW key fob is easy and does not require any special tools or skills. In fact, you can complete the task yourself in less than five minutes!

The first step is to locate the battery. Once you've located it remove the valet key and make use of a screwdriver for opening the case. It will reveal a tiny gap that is where the battery should be. Remove the battery carefully and replace it with the new one. Be sure to align the battery correctly. Close the case and press both halves until a snapping sound can be heard.

It is crucial to programme your new battery in the specifications of your BMW. Consult your owner's guide for specific instructions for your car model and manufacturer. Typically, this involves pressing a set of buttons in a specific sequence, however it could vary depending on your vehicle.
